
I think it is safe to say that we all miss concerts. A lot of people are willing to assume risks and do whatever is asked to get them back.
We all know that concerts, movies, and other large public gatherings are going to change. The question is HOW?
According to Britain’s “Mirror” tabloid, the music industry is hoping to get concerts up and running by the fall . . . and they might do it by having fans walk through a DISINFECTANT MIST on their way into the venue.
Temperature-taking and masks could also be part of the new normal.
(Having your temperature taken and wearing a mask are simple enough . . . although plenty of people have shown that they can’t even handle that.)
